Road Closure Update

Work should be completed by 6pm today to remove the barriers blocking traffic along the B1383 (Stanted Road).

In their place a three-way traffic management system will be in operation controlling traffic into and out of the Forest Hall Road junction.

The lights will remain for the next week (possibly longer) until Affinity Water install a new water main in the area.

Compensation

Uttlesford District Council’s business support team have been in Stansted today distributing literature to local businesses from Affinity Water explaining how they can apply for compensation.

The policy document from Affinity Water explains the legal basis for compensation is Schedule 12 of the Water Industry Act 1991.

It says to be entitled to compensation you must prove that:

  • You have sustained particular loss or damage other than, and beyond, the general inconvenience experienced by the public and this loss was direct and substantial.
  • Your premises must be sufficiently close to the site of our works for a clear causal link to be made between the works and the loss.

If you consider you may be entitled to compensation, you can email details of your claim to claimsteam@affinitywater.co.uk or write to at Tamblin Way, Hatfield, AL10 9EZ. Claims will be acknowledged within 5 working days of receipt.
